Transaction c670d24335555b9730f01c1781d6f23da5bdf68fcb19d7de6d76d29e3d5aad51
1 Input
1 Output
-
c670d24335555b9730f01c1781d6f23da5bdf68fcb19d7de6d76d29e3d5aad51:0
- value
- 60973
- script pubkey
- OP_0 OP_PUSHBYTES_20 316901b1a611e7d9d9a4dac84632481653a65985
- address
- bc1qx95srvdxz8nankdymtyyvvjgzef6vkv9786jku